Working for United Ground Express as a ramp agent in California has been one of the most frustrating experiences of my life. For the back-breaking work we do—lifting heavy bags, operating equipment in extreme weather, handling aircraft turnaround times under pressure—we’re paid a measly $18/hour. That’s barely enough to survive in California, let alone have any quality of life. The management is completely out of touch with what it’s like to work on the ramp. We’re constantly understaffed, rushed, and expected to do more with less. Safety often feels like an afterthought, and turnover is so high that we’re always training new people while trying to get flights out on time. There’s little to no upward mobility, morale is low, and the benefits are the bare minimum. We keep planes moving and passengers happy, but get treated like we’re disposable. If you’re thinking about joining UGE as a ramp agent, do yourself a favor and look somewhere else unless you’re desperate for a paycheck.
